REQUIREMENTS:
- 4+ years typically
- Stays current with many best-of-breed technologies
- Programs proficiently in several languages and is comfortable switching between them
- Shows a commitment to quality by implementing suitable software using unit/integration and acceptance testing at the time of feature development
- Develops data models or schemas from scratch and knows of key concepts such as ACID, Normalization, and Transactions
- Debugs large components with limited assistance and assists other engineers with debugging
- Actively participates in providing feedback on others' designs/code
- Performs as an expert in one or more parts of the software lifecycle (e.g., coding, testing, and deployment). Oversees significant pieces of development within the development lifecycle
- Designs and develops practical APIs and abstractions.
- Owns technical debt in their own software
- Proficient in SQL and Relational Database Concepts and Design
- Proficient in JavaScript
- Extensive experience in JavaScript frameworks like jQuery, Reactjs, NodeJS and AngularJS
- Experience in building or interfacing with RESTful Services
- Experience in the Agile environment and working knowledge of user stories, features and acceptance criteria
- Experience developing web applications using Spring MVC Desired
- Experience with AEM (Adobe Experience Manager)
- Experience with Client ALM
- Skilled in the use of RALLY agile tracking tool
